I recently attempted to load the new Marlin 1.1.8 code referenced in this forum on my GT2560A board. This is the none PLUS board.

I am using a 3D-Touch bed leveling sensor configured as per the instructions I was provided two and a half years ago. The printer works fine with the old 1.0.x code, but i want to use some of the newer features of the 1.1.x code.

I found the PINs files are "sort of hard coded" to the new PLUS version of the board.

If you have the BOARD_NAME defined as the GT2560A+ the pins-gt2560a+ file is included at compile time. that file looks like this:

Code: Select all

/**
 * Geeetech GT2560 Revision A+ board pin assignments
 */

#define BOARD_NAME "GT2560 Rev.A+"

#include "pins_GT2560_REV_A.h"

#if ENABLED(BLTOUCH)
  #define SERVO0_PIN  11
#else
  #define SERVO0_PIN  32
#endif

If you have the BOARD_NAME defined as the GT2560A there is no reference for a BL-Touch in the pins_GT2560A file. It looks like this:

I have a work around that corrects the lack of BL-Touch pin assignments for a GT2560A. I would not try to use this modified code for a GT2560A+ board however.

My work around:

Code: Select all

//
// Limit Switches
//
#define X_MIN_PIN          22
#define X_MAX_PIN          24
#define Y_MIN_PIN          26
#define Y_MAX_PIN          28
#define Z_MIN_PIN          30
//#define Z_MAX_PIN          32

#if ENABLED(BLTOUCH)
     #define Z_MAX_PIN -1
     #define SERVO0_PIN 32
#else
     #define Z_MAX_PIN 32
     #define SERVO0_PIN 13
#endif

//
// Steppers
/
___________________________________________________________________________________________________________________________

With these changes the auto homing and bed leveling from the control panel appear to work fine.
